Bushfire Fundraiser – A success! Last Friday we, along with many schools around Bendigo, hosted an out of uniform day as part of a HIT FM fundraiser for the Fire appeal. Our school raised $350 towards the appeal and shall donate our funds to the local CFA. Thank you to everyone who donated on the day. Well done!
